Many taxpayers are eligible for deductions and benefits related to education expenses under income tax rules. Understanding these benefits can help optimize tax savings and manage education costs effectively.
Tax Deductions for Education Expenses
Income tax laws provide deductions for certain education-related expenses. These deductions are applicable for tuition fees, examination fees, and other approved costs associated with higher education or vocational training.
Eligible Expenses and Limits
Eligible expenses typically include tuition fees paid to educational institutions, examination fees, and costs for books and supplies. The maximum deduction amount varies depending on the specific tax laws and the type of education.
Tax Benefits for Specific Education Programs
Some income tax rules offer additional benefits for certain education programs, such as vocational training or courses approved by government authorities. These benefits may include tax credits or exemptions.
Additional Support and Incentives
Taxpayers can also explore other incentives like scholarships, grants, or education loans that may have tax advantages. Consulting with a tax professional can help identify all applicable benefits.
